Annual ADSHE Conference 2016
Neurodiversity and 1:1 Specialist Study Skills
save the date!
Thursday 30th June 2016 at Conference Aston, Birmingham

Call for workshop proposals
Workshop proposals are now invited for the Annual ADSHE Conference 2016.
The theme for conference is Neurodiversity and 1:1 Specialist Study Skills
Deadline for proposals is Sunday 31st January 2016
Successful workshop proposals will be confirmed mid February 2016
Information for presenters:
* 1st presenter attends conference free of charge
* 2nd presenters pay full price but may apply for the Liz Ahrends bursary or have the opportunity for fees to be met via exhibitor sponsorship
* travel costs and resources are incurred at presenters’ own expense
The presenters of each workshop will be asked to forward a summary of their workshop ready for a Conference Journal edition as follows:
* written summary will be submitted in advance of conference by Friday 10th June 2016
* presenters wanting to add any contributions from delegates after their workshop will send this additional information by Friday 1st July 2016
* 1,500 – 2,500 words
* will be Harvard referenced where applicable
* will comply with the same ethical guidelines as the Journal of Neurodiversity in Higher Education<http://adshe.org.uk/journal-of-neurodiversity-in-higher-education/>
